机器人编程准备材料是什么
-
机器人编程准备材料主要包括以下几个方面:
1.硬件设备:包括机器人主体、传感器、执行器等。机器人主体可以是各种类型的机械结构,如机械臂、小车、无人机等。传感器用于感知周围环境,常见的传感器包括摄像头、红外线传感器、超声波传感器等。执行器用于实现机器人的动作,如电机、舵机等。
2.开发板:机器人编程通常需要使用开发板进行控制。常见的开发板有Arduino、Raspberry Pi、STM32等。开发板上面有各种接口,可以连接传感器和执行器,并通过编程控制它们的工作。
3.编程软件:机器人编程可以使用各种编程语言,如C、C++、Python等。不同的开发板和机器人平台可能有不同的编程环境和库函数。对于初学者来说,可以选择一些简单易用的编程软件,如Arduino IDE、Python IDLE等。
4.学习资源:学习机器人编程需要参考一些相关的学习资料和教程。可以通过图书、网络视频、在线教程等方式获取相关知识。同时,可以参加一些机器人编程的培训班或者参加机器人竞赛,通过实践来提高编程技能。
5.团队合作:机器人编程通常需要多人合作完成,因此团队合作也是准备材料之一。团队成员可以相互交流、分享经验,共同解决问题,提高编程效率。
综上所述,机器人编程准备材料包括硬件设备、开发板、编程软件、学习资源和团队合作。通过充分准备这些材料,可以更好地进行机器人编程工作。
1年前 -
机器人编程准备材料包括以下内容:
1.硬件设备:机器人编程需要使用相应的硬件设备,如机器人本体、传感器、执行器等。根据不同的机器人类型和应用场景,硬件设备的种类和规格会有所不同。
2.编程语言和开发环境:机器人编程可以使用不同的编程语言,如C++、Python、Java等。选择合适的编程语言要考虑机器人硬件平台的支持情况和开发者的编程经验。同时,还需要安装相应的开发环境,如IDE(集成开发环境)或文本编辑器。
3.开发工具和库:机器人编程需要使用一些开发工具和库来简化开发过程,提供相关的功能和接口。例如,ROS(机器人操作系统)是一个广泛使用的开发框架,提供了一系列的库和工具,用于机器人的感知、控制和导航等任务。
4.学习资料和教程:机器人编程是一个复杂的领域,需要掌握一定的理论知识和实践经验。因此,准备机器人编程的材料包括学习资料和教程,如教科书、在线课程、教学视频等。这些材料可以帮助开发者理解机器人编程的基本原理和实践技巧。
5.实验平台和测试环境:为了验证机器人编程的正确性和性能,需要准备相应的实验平台和测试环境。实验平台可以是一个仿真环境或真实的机器人平台,用于测试和调试编写的程序。测试环境可以包括一些测试工具和设备,用于检测机器人的传感器数据、执行器状态等。
综上所述,机器人编程准备材料包括硬件设备、编程语言和开发环境、开发工具和库、学习资料和教程,以及实验平台和测试环境。这些材料的准备可以帮助开发者顺利进行机器人编程的学习和实践。
1年前 -
机器人编程准备材料主要包括以下几个方面:
-
机器人硬件:机器人编程需要有相应的机器人硬件,包括机器人本体、传感器、执行器等。不同类型的机器人需要不同的硬件设备,例如工业机器人、教育机器人、服务机器人等。
-
电脑或控制器:机器人编程需要使用电脑或控制器来进行程序编写和控制。通常情况下,需要一台能够连接到机器人的电脑或控制器,以便进行编程和调试。
-
编程软件:机器人编程需要使用相应的编程软件来进行程序编写。不同的机器人可能需要使用不同的编程软件,常见的包括ROS(机器人操作系统)、LabVIEW(实验室虚拟仪器工程师系统)等。
-
编程语言:机器人编程需要使用编程语言来编写程序。常见的机器人编程语言包括C++、Python、Java等。不同的机器人可能对编程语言有不同的要求,需要根据实际情况选择合适的编程语言。
-
传感器和执行器:机器人编程需要了解和使用机器人的传感器和执行器。传感器用于获取环境信息,执行器用于执行机器人的动作。常见的传感器包括摄像头、激光雷达、触摸传感器等;常见的执行器包括电机、舵机、液压缸等。
-
资源和资料:机器人编程需要有相关的资源和资料供参考和学习。可以通过阅读书籍、参加培训课程、查阅互联网上的教程和文档等方式获取相关的资源和资料。
总之,机器人编程准备材料包括机器人硬件、电脑或控制器、编程软件、编程语言、传感器和执行器,以及相关的资源和资料。根据具体的机器人类型和需求,还可能需要其他特定的准备材料。
1年前 -